Movie mania

It was only a matter of time. The Netflix business model has been launched down under in the form of Meteor Entertainment. The concept goes a little something like this: you pay a subscription fee and then choose movies to rent online, they send you the movies and you keep them as long as it takes for you to watch them. Once you send those movies back, they send you your next selections.

I think this'd be great if you were a movie addict with niche tastes that your local rental shops didn't stock, or if you were a sociophobic recluse or an ultra-sensitive 'boy in a bubble' type, but I don't think it's for me. I'd get too annoyed if the discs were all scratched up & unplayable, plus I like to support the local businesses around here, even if they are franchises, and have I mentioned how cute some of the girls down at Video Ezy are.
